Release: Report shows National underfunds health – Labour fixes it.
A new report has confirmed what New Zealanders know: National cuts healthcare, Labour restores it.
“This two-decade analysis is clear - National starves the health system and Labour brings it back into line with international standards,” Labour’s health spokesperson Ayesha Verrall said.
“History is repeating itself. Instead of properly funding healthcare, Christopher Luxon is handing out tax cuts to property speculators and tobacco companies.
“The report states the real-world impact of underfunding: staff shortages, fewer hospital beds, and higher GP costs – all of which are getting worse under National.
“Everyone deserves affordable care close to home, without the long waits. But under Christopher Luxon, it’s harder and more expensive to see a doctor or nurse. That means people stay sicker for longer, while hospitals buckle under the pressure.
“The Government should listen to this report. Now is the time to keep building on Labour’s progress – not tear it down.
“Labour will make it cheaper and easier to get care close to home – so you get help when you need it, and hospitals are there when it matters most,” Ayesha Verrall said.
